The Residential Manager oversees the day-to-day operations of a residential care facility serving individuals with intellectual disabilities and / or behavioral disorders under ODP 6400 Regulations. This position ensures that the facility operates in compliance with all regulatory requirements, providing high-quality care, supervision, and support to individuals in accordance with their Individual Support Plans (ISPs). The Residential Manager is responsible for managing staff, maintaining a safe and supportive environment, and working closely with families, service providers, and other stakeholders.
Key Responsibilities :
- Ensure compliance with ODP 6400 Regulations and other applicable federal, state, and local laws.
- Supervise and provide leadership to direct care staff, ensuring they are trained, supported, and perform duties in alignment with policies and regulations.
- Oversee the implementation and monitoring of individualized care plans and ISPs for each resident.
- Provide direct support and supervision to residents, ensuring their safety, well-being, and personal development.
- Conduct regular assessments of residents' needs, making adjustments to care plans as necessary.
- Manage the daily operations of the residential facility, including maintaining cleanliness, orderliness, and a homelike environment.
- Monitor and track the health and medication needs of residents, ensuring proper documentation and reporting of any medical or behavioral changes.
- Ensure that all incidents are documented and reported according to agency policies and regulatory requirements.
- Assist in developing, implementing, and reviewing policies and procedures that ensure high-quality care and compliance with regulatory standards.
- Collaborate with external service providers, families, and other stakeholders to ensure that residents’ needs are met and concerns are addressed.
- Conduct regular staff meetings and provide performance feedback to team members.
- Participate in the recruitment, hiring, and training of new staff members.
- Ensure that all required documentation, including training, incident reports, and care plans, are completed accurately and on time.
- Prepare and manage budgets for the residential care program, including cost-effective purchasing and resource allocation.
- Provide on-call support as needed for emergency situations and to ensure continuous operation of the facility.
